Hello,

I just installed Afterlogic Xmail server on
Windows Server 2003, IIS 6, SQL server 2005.
Everything went pretty well except for one
thing. When I try to configure the WebMail in
the database settings section I can't connect
or create tables. I've tried mailadm user,
local administrator, my domain admin account,
created new account into SQL server. Basicly i
tried all possibility i can think of. The SQL
server is on the same server that Xmail server
is installed.

Anyone have an idea to help me?

Default way of SQL database connection in WebMail Pro is to provide hostname (usually "localhost"), database name, username and password. Please note that it is not about Windows authentication data, you need SQL Server credentials.

Alternatively, you can specify ODBC connection string directly in WebMail Pro settings, or add this to your ODBC Data Sources and refer to it using DSN name.
